To understand how Super Resolution works, you need to know about Raw Details Enhancer as it uses a similar technique.Įach pixel your camera captures is only one of three colours: red, green or blue. If you’ve got an archive of images taken with older generation DSLR cameras, Super Resolution can open them up to new potential. It doesn’t just work on RAW files either, you can run this on JPEG and TIFF, meaning you can, in theory, now get a lot more mileage out of your photographs. This is the equivalent of increasing your pixel count a whopping 4 times. In a similar way to Raw Details (formerly Enhance Details) it sharpens edges, improves colour and reduces artifacts, but its biggest claim is to do all of this plus 2x the linear resolution (twice the width and height of the original). ![]() Super Resolution is fairly new, having been introduced in ACR 13.2. ![]()
